Tanaka, in Creep-Resistant … WebFor piercing a hole: Tonnage = d * t * 80 Equation 1. In this equation d is the punch diameter in inches, t is the material thickness in inches, and it gives the tonnage in tons. This was a very simple and effective way to estimate the tonnage of all the holes pierced. Let us look at how this rule of thumb was derived.
